Installation/Set-Up Challenges for Carbon Steel Gib Head Keys
When using Carbon Steel Gib Head Keys, common installation or setup challenges may include:
Incorrect key size: Using the wrong size of Gib Head Key can lead to improper fit and alignment, causing issues with torque transmission and component stability.
Keyway dimensional errors: If the keyway dimensions are not accurate or consistent with the Gib Head Key dimensions, installation can be difficult or impossible.
Key misalignment: Improper alignment of the key and keyway can result in stress concentration, reduced load-bearing capacity, and potential failure of the shaft-key connection.
Key material quality: Low-quality Carbon Steel Gib Head Keys may bend or break under heavy loads or over time, leading to equipment downtime and maintenance issues.
Proper key seating: Ensuring that the Gib Head Key is correctly seated in the keyway without any gaps is crucial for effective torque transmission and overall system performance.
Tightening torque: Applying the correct tightening torque during installation is important to prevent loosening of the key and maintain secure shaft-key locking.
Surface finish: Rough or uneven key and keyway surfaces can cause interference during installation, affecting the fit and overall performance of the Gib Head Key.
Addressing these challenges through proper selection, installation procedures, and maintenance practices can help ensure the effective and reliable use of Carbon Steel Gib Head Keys in industrial applications.
